Appliance Repair Tips That Can Save Homeowners Hundreds of Dollars
Home appliances work hard day by day, but many homeowners replace or call for repairs far before necessary. With the correct approach, primary maintenance and a few smart repair habits can significantly reduce household expenses. Understanding how you can care for common appliances can extend their lifespan and enable you avoid costly service calls.
Start With Common Maintenance
Routine maintenance is among the most effective ways to stop costly appliance failures. Simple tasks such as cleaning fridge coils, checking washing machine hoses, and emptying dryer lint traps can improve effectivity and reduce wear. Neglecting these basics typically leads to overheating, leaks, or motor failure, which often require professional repairs.
Most manufacturers embrace upkeep guidelines in the person manual. Following these recommendations helps keep appliances running smoothly and preserves energy efficiency, lowering utility bills over time.
Diagnose the Problem Earlier than Calling a Technician
Many appliance points have easy causes that homeowners can fix themselves. A dishwasher that will not start might have a tripped breaker or a door latch that is not totally engaged. A dryer that isn't heating may very well be caused by a clogged vent reasonably than a broken heating element.
Before calling a repair service, check energy connections, settings, and visual components. Online hassleshooting guides and videos can help determine frequent problems and options, probably saving hundreds of dollars in service fees.
Replace Small Parts Instead of Complete Units
Appliances are often replaced when a single part fails. Components like belts, thermostats, valves, and door seals are often inexpensive and comparatively easy to install. For instance, replacing a worn washing machine belt costs far less than shopping for a new machine.
Look up your appliance model number to seek out appropriate replacement parts. Many parts suppliers provide detailed diagrams that make set up simpler for homeowners with fundamental tools and patience.
Know When Repairs Are Worth It
Not each equipment is value fixing. A general rule is the 50 % guideline. If a repair costs more than half the worth of a new appliance and the unit is near the end of its anticipated lifespan, replacement may be the higher option.
Nonetheless, newer appliances with minor issues are often worth repairing. Understanding the age, condition, and energy effectivity of your appliance helps you make informed decisions that protect your budget.
Avoid Common User Errors
Many appliance breakdowns are caused by improper use. Overloading washing machines, using incorrect detergents, or blocking airflow around refrigerators can lead to premature failure. Reading utilization directions and respecting load limits can forestall unnecessary damage.
Utilizing the precise cleaning products is equally important. Harsh chemical compounds can damage seals, hoses, and internal elements, resulting in leaks or reduced performance.
Invest in Preventive Upgrades
Some upgrades can prevent future repair costs. Installing surge protectors for fridges and electronic appliances protects sensitive elements from energy fluctuations. Changing rubber hoses with braided stainless steel hoses on washing machines reduces the risk of leaks and water damage.
These small investments often pay for themselves by stopping major repairs or insurance claims.
Keep a Repair and Upkeep Log
Tracking repairs and maintenance helps you notice recurring issues and evaluate whether an appliance is changing into unreliable. A simple log can embody service dates, replaced parts, and upkeep tasks completed.
This information is also helpful when selling a home, as well maintained appliances can add perceived value and reassure potential buyers.
Smart appliance care isn't about turning into a professional technician. It is about understanding frequent problems, practicing regular upkeep, and making informed decisions. By making use of these appliance repair ideas, homeowners can avoid unnecessary bills and keep their appliances running efficiently for years.
